The primary goal of this website is to share what is required to set up a web server from scratch, how to secure it, how to maintain it, how to back up and how to use WordPress as a CMS to publish and organize web content.
My goal is to help those who are just starting or interested in learning Linux, with this website serving as an HTML and CSS playground for me to learn UI/UX development.
This web server is running on a Debian based Linux distribution in a DigitalOcean Droplet. I’m using an NGINX service to serve web requests, WordPress as a content management system, a SQL server with a PHP framework to power backend processes and page generation.